#9D164C Hex Color Code

#9D164C

The Hexadecimal Color #9D164C is a contrast shade of Brown. #9D164C RGB value is rgb(157, 22, 76). RGB Color Model of #9D164C consists of 61% red, 8% green and 29% blue. HSL color Mode of #9D164C has 336°(degrees) Hue, 75% Saturation and 35% Lightness. #9D164C color has an wavelength of 408.44444n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#9D164C is #CC3366.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#9D164C is #914. The Closest Color to #9D164C is #A52A2A. Official Name of #9D164C Hex Code is Disco.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#9D164C is 0 Cyan 86 Magenta 52 Yellow 38 Black and #9D164C CMY is 0, 86, 52.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#9D164C is hsl(336,75,35,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(336, 86, 62).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#9D164C is 15.5, 8.27, 7.62.
Hex8 Value of #9D164C is #9D164CFF. Decimal Value of #9D164C is 10294860 and Octal Value of #9D164C is 47213114. Binary Value of #9D164C is 10011101, 10110, 1001100 and Android of #9D164C is 4288484940 / 0xff9d164c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#9D164C is 0.494, 0.263, 0.263 and YIQ Color Space of #9D164C is 68.521, 63.0963, 45.3573.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#9D164C is 13.67, 3.18, 7.65.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#9D164C is 34.54, 55.33, 4.72.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#9D164C is 34.54, 82.58, -4.52.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#9D164C is 34.54, 55.53, 4.88. Hunter Lab variable of #9D164C is 28.76, 45.88, 4.42.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#9D164C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
